Use Euclid’s Ladder (or a factor tree) to write the prime factorization.
1. 64
2. 100
3. 54

I can’t do factor trees on here, but I’ll try my best

64 =
32, 2 =
16, 2, 2 =
8, 2, 2, 2 =
4, 2, 2, 2, 2 =
2, 2, 2, 2, 2 =
2^5

100 =
50, 2 =
25, 2, 2 =
5, 5, 2, 2 =
2^2 * 5^2

54 =
27, 2 =
9, 3, 2 =
3, 3, 3, 2 =
3^3 * 2
